  • Patent number: 12266510
    Abstract: A plasma treatment device is provided and includes a first electrode, a dielectric body supportive of the first electrode and a second mesh electrode having an opposite polarity as the first electrode and comprising a seating portion. The second mesh electrode is disposed proximate to the dielectric body to define a gap receptive of particles for collection in the seating portion. The gap is sized such that, with the second mesh electrode activated, a plasma field is generated to treat the particles in the seating portion. The seating portion is configured to retain the particles during treatment in opposition to ionic winds resulting from the plasma field.

  • Publication number: 20230363075
    Abstract: A plasma treatment device includes dielectric plates arranged in parallel, sets of active electrodes disposed on outwardly facing sides of the dielectric plates, respectively, and ground electrodes interposed between inwardly facing sides of the dielectric plates. The sets of active electrodes and the ground electrodes are arranged to define a plasma treatment zone, which exhibits multi-axis symmetry and which is receptive of particles, and are operable to generate plasma for plasma treating the particles therein.
